Output 3d1039d0c5ee97b3f81b8afabef3350971a4cfb1ca6e3fb9b4136615fbe5da68:1

value
16943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93deed6b234590bc4a132a08d3825ce1090482b5 OP_EQUAL
address
3FAtK1c4BZDfMXsqPiBx6t1ZBKWrq9ejq5
transaction
3d1039d0c5ee97b3f81b8afabef3350971a4cfb1ca6e3fb9b4136615fbe5da68
confirmations
240767
spent
true